Secret Criteria for Reviewing Casino Games
When a customer takes a seat to evaluate a casino video game, an organized technique guarantees consistency and depth. The following criteria are universally acknowledged as vital:
- Return‑to‑Player (RTP)-- The theoretical payout percentage over an extended play session. Higher RTP indicates a more player‑friendly video game.
- Volatility (Variance)-- Describes the threat level. Low‑volatility games provide frequent, smaller wins; high‑volatility titles use bigger payouts but less regular hits.
- House Edge-- The casino's mathematical advantage. A lower home edge translates into better chances for the player.
- Video game Mechanics & & Features-- Includes payline structures, wild signs, multipliers, free‑spin rounds, and interactive perk games.
- Software Provider Reputation-- Established designers such as Microgaming, NetEnt, and Playtech are known for rigorous screening and reasonable play accreditations.
- Graphics & & Sound Design-- Visual fidelity, animation quality, and audio coherence contribute to immersion.
- Mobile Compatibility-- The capability to carry out seamlessly on smart devices and tablets is a definitive factor for modern-day players.
- Security & & Licensing-- Verification that the game runs under a respectable gambling authority and utilizes encrypted random‑number generation.

Top Tips for Choosing a Casino Game
Players can utilize the above criteria to streamline their choice process. The following list uses actionable guidance:
- Prioritize RTP: If sustained play is the objective, go with titles with an RTP of 96% or greater.
- Match Volatility to Bankroll: Low‑volatility games extend playtime, while high‑volatility choices suit those comfortable with risking bigger stakes for bigger payments.
- Verify Provider Credibility: Stick to games from developers that hold licenses from appreciated jurisdictions (e.g., UK Gambling Commission, Malta Gaming Authority).
- Test Before Committing: Many online casinos supply demo modes; use these to determine mechanics and graphics without financial danger.
- Examine Mobile Support: Ensure the game's HTML5 variation runs smoothly on your preferred gadget, with no considerable lag or design issues.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q1: What does RTP in fact tell me about a game?A: RTP represents
the portion of total wagers that a game is set to return to gamers over an infinite variety of spins. For instance, a 96% RTP implies that, statistically, the video game returns ₤ 96 for every ₤ 100 bet. It does not ensure private sessions however provides a long‑term expectation.
Q2: How does volatility impact my gameplay experience?A: Volatility
figures out the danger profile. Low‑volatility games pay smaller quantities regularly, making them perfect for extended play and lower bankrolls. High‑volatility titles can go lots of spins without a win, but when a payment takes place, it tends to be substantial.
Q3: Are progressive prize games worth playing?A: Progressive games
use life‑changing sums, however they typically have a lower base RTP and higher volatility. They are best matched for players who delight in the adventure of a huge possible win and can afford the associated danger. Q4: How can I validate that a game is fair?A: Look for certification seals from screening agencies such as eCOGRA or iTech Labs. These organizations audit random‑number generators(RNG) and payment portions to ensure compliance with market requirements.
